Subject: [PATCH] fs: show frozen status in mountinfo

Putting this in the mountinfo makes it non contractual, and purely
available for the sake of helping out an administrator seeing blocking
behavior.

Signed-off-by: Florian Margaine <florian@platform.sh>
---
 fs/proc_namespace.c | 2 ++
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+)

diff --git a/fs/proc_namespace.c b/fs/proc_namespace.c
index b5713fe..2b8e3dd 100644
--- a/fs/proc_namespace.c
+++ b/fs/proc_namespace.c
@@ -184,6 +184,8 @@ static int show_mountinfo(struct seq_file *m, struct vfsmount *mnt)
 		goto out;
 	if (sb->s_op->show_options)
 		err = sb->s_op->show_options(m, mnt->mnt_root);
+	if (sb->s_writers.frozen)
+		seq_puts(m, " frozen");
 	seq_putc(m, '\n');
 out:
 	return err;
